Product Features
Comprehensive coverage options tailored to your needs.
Eligibility
- Anyone who property or has a ligal responsiblity for the safety of property, e.g., Owners of goods traded, Business owners, Manufacturers and Distributors, etc. is eligible to get insurance.
Policy Term
- Coverage is applicable for a single voyage.
Premium Rating
- It ranges from 0.14% to 0.84% on insured value and the rating varies according to the followings.
- 1. Type of Cargo
- 2. Voyage
- 3. The season of the trip to be carried
Coverage
- 1. Fire or explosion
- 2. Vessel or craft being stranded grounded sunk or capsized
- 3. Overturning or derailment of land conveyance
- 4. Coverage for discharge of cargo at a port of distress
- 5. Collision or contract of vessel/craft or conveyance with any external object other than water
